From nobody  Tue Aug 25 20:15:28 1998
Received: (from nobody@localhost)
          by hub.freebsd.org (8.8.8/8.8.8) id UAA00525;
          Tue, 25 Aug 1998 20:15:28 -0700 (PDT)
          (envelope-from nobody)
Message-Id: <199808260315.UAA00525@hub.freebsd.org>
Date: Tue, 25 Aug 1998 20:15:28 -0700 (PDT)
From: taoka@infonets.hiroshima-u.ac.jp
To: freebsd-gnats-submit@freebsd.org
Subject: cannot compile japanese/onew-* on 3.0-CURRENT
X-Send-Pr-Version: www-1.0

>Number:         7747
>Category:       ports
>Synopsis:       cannot compile japanese/onew-* on 3.0-CURRENT
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    kuriyama
>State:          closed
>Quarter:        
>Keywords:       
>Date-Required:  
>Class:          change-request
>Submitter-Id:   current-users
>Arrival-Date:   Tue Aug 25 20:20:00 PDT 1998
>Closed-Date:    Sat Sep 26 22:06:46 PDT 1998
>Last-Modified:  Sat Sep 26 22:07:24 PDT 1998
>Originator:     Satoshi TAOKA
>Release:        
>Organization:
Hiroshima University in Japan
>Environment:
>Description:
We cannot compile japanese/onew-* on 3.0-CURRENT,
because /usr/include/regex.h is different from one of 2.X-RELEASE.


>How-To-Repeat:

>Fix:
First, you make a new direcotory, /usr/ports/japanese/onew-wnn4/patches.
Next, please add the next patch as patch-aa into the directory.

--- sys/regex.c.orig	Fri Jun 30 13:56:01 1995
+++ ./sys/regex.c	Wed Aug 26 03:14:57 1998
@@ -41,6 +41,9 @@
 #include <stdio.h>
 #include <sys/types.h>
 #endif
+#if __FreeBSD__ >= 3
+#include <sys/types.h>
+#endif
 #include <regex.h>
 
 static regex_t REXP;

>Release-Note:
>Audit-Trail:

From: Satoshi Taoka <taoka@infonets.hiroshima-u.ac.jp>
To: FreeBSD-gnats-submit@freebsd.org, freebsd-ports@freebsd.org
Cc:  Subject: Re: ports/7747: cannot compile japanese/onew-* on 3.0-CURRENT
Date: Sat, 05 Sep 1998 11:24:59 +0900

 ----Next_Part(Sat_Sep__5_11:24:54_1998_809)--
 Content-Type: Text/Plain; charset=us-ascii
 Content-Transfer-Encoding: 7bit
 
 
 I am the maintainer of japanese/onew-*.
 Please apply the next patch for japanese/onew-*.
 
 Thanks.
 
 -- S. TAOKA
 
 
 ----Next_Part(Sat_Sep__5_11:24:54_1998_809)--
 Content-Type: Text/Plain; charset=us-ascii
 Content-Transfer-Encoding: 7bit
 Content-Description: onew-patch
 
 diff -ur -x patches /usr/ports/japanese/onew-wnn4/files/ONEW_CONF-for-canna+wnn6 japanese/onew-wnn4/files/ONEW_CONF-for-canna+wnn6
 --- /usr/ports/japanese/onew-wnn4/files/ONEW_CONF-for-canna+wnn6	Wed Jul  8 23:29:30 1998
 +++ japanese/onew-wnn4/files/ONEW_CONF-for-canna+wnn6	Fri Sep  4 14:55:41 1998
 @@ -1,7 +1,7 @@
  WNNINC		= -I%X11BASE%/include/wnn
  WNNLIB		= -L%X11BASE%/lib -ljd
  WNN_RKPATH      = '"./rk:$$ONEW_WNN_ROMKAND:$$ONEW_ROMKAND:$$HOME/.rk:%LOCALBASE%/lib/wnn/ja_JP/rk.wnn6:%LOCALBASE%/lib/wnn/ja_JP/rk:/tmp/onew_rktabs/wnn"'
 -WNN_DICLIST	= '"kihon tankan tankan3 zip ikeiji symbol tankan2 tel usr/$$USER/ud=10 usr/$$USER/private=10"'
 +WNN_DICLIST	= '"kihon tankan zip symbol tankan2 tel usr/$$USER/ud=10 usr/$$USER/private=10"'
  WNN_DICDIRS	= '"iwanami/%s.dic;usr/$$USER/%s.h"'
  CANNAINC	= -I%LOCALBASE%/include
  CANNAOBJ	= Canna.o CannaRk.o
 diff -ur -x patches /usr/ports/japanese/onew-wnn4/files/ONEW_CONF-for-wnn6 japanese/onew-wnn4/files/ONEW_CONF-for-wnn6
 --- /usr/ports/japanese/onew-wnn4/files/ONEW_CONF-for-wnn6	Wed Jul  8 23:29:30 1998
 +++ japanese/onew-wnn4/files/ONEW_CONF-for-wnn6	Fri Sep  4 14:56:02 1998
 @@ -1,7 +1,7 @@
  WNNINC		= -I%X11BASE%/include/wnn
  WNNLIB		= -L%X11BASE%/lib -ljd
  WNN_RKPATH      = '"./rk:$$ONEW_WNN_ROMKAND:$$ONEW_ROMKAND:$$HOME/.rk:%LOCALBASE%/lib/wnn/ja_JP/rk.wnn6:%LOCALBASE%/lib/wnn/ja_JP/rk:/tmp/onew_rktabs/wnn"'
 -WNN_DICLIST	= '"kihon tankan tankan3 zip ikeiji symbol tankan2 tel usr/$$USER/ud=10 usr/$$USER/private=10"'
 +WNN_DICLIST	= '"kihon tankan zip symbol tankan2 tel usr/$$USER/ud=10 usr/$$USER/private=10"'
  WNN_DICDIRS	= '"iwanami/%s.dic;usr/$$USER/%s.h"'
  RKKLIBS		= $(WNNLIB)
  RKKOBJS		= $(WNNOBJ)
 
 ----Next_Part(Sat_Sep__5_11:24:54_1998_809)----
State-Changed-From-To: open->suspended 
State-Changed-By: kuriyama 
State-Changed-When: Tue Sep 15 15:01:12 PDT 1998 
State-Changed-Why:  
Originator's request. 


Responsible-Changed-From-To: freebsd-ports->kuriyama 
Responsible-Changed-By: kuriyama 
Responsible-Changed-When: Tue Sep 15 15:01:12 PDT 1998 
Responsible-Changed-Why:  
State-Changed-From-To: suspended->closed 
State-Changed-By: kuriyama 
State-Changed-When: Sat Sep 26 22:06:46 PDT 1998 
State-Changed-Why:  
Committed.  Thanks! 
>Unformatted:
